This role will report to the Business Intelligence Lead. You will be expected to work independently but also flexibly as part of a team. To enhance data driven decision making you will assist in the build and implementation of products that transform the way we manage and interact with data, creating innovative solutions that ultimately provide an intuitive experience for a wide array of users primarily within Finance, HR and Commercial. These products will be held within the Corporate BI Platform, comprising two components: a data warehouse and reporting/dashboarding tools. The initial focus of the BI platform has been the core Finance and HR reporting and data processes, but we plan to expand the platform to bring in a range of other non-corporate data sources as well. As the Junior Business Intelligence Developer your key responsibilities will be Technically facilitate the expansion of the BI platform data warehouse, through developing data extraction, transformation and loading (ETL) pipelines. Collaborate with teams across DCMS to assist the BI team in understanding reporting requirements. Assist the BI team with the creation of self service, user intuitive reports within a business analytics reporting tool (currently Looker Studio). Assist in the transition from a Google-based environment to Microsoft 365 by adapting and replicating existing processes to ensure seamless functionality within the new platform.
